My course was for a duration of three years holding a full-time graduation degree. It had six semesters in total with really interesting subjects such as Theatre Studies, Elizabethan Age, English Language and Literature, Drama and Creative Writing.

The college offers on-campus job program for the students to make them independent and responsible. It arranges appointments on the basis of references and interviews. The college also provides Job orientation to all the selected students.

Fee Structure And Facilities

My course fee was feasible with a grand total of INR 59,820 which included tuition fees, other fees etc. The tuition fee was different for each year. At the time of admission, I paid a sum of INR 200 for the registration.

I got admission in the college by filling the admission registration form which is available online on the college's website. The admissions are completely based on the marks you score in the CBSE 12th examination.

From my seniors, I hear that 20/30 % of students from our college get placed. But now being in my final sem I know the reality. For covid and lockdown, the placement sector has been badly hit. Only a handful of companies came this year (5/6 companies). 4/5 people from our batch are placed but no placement for the big chunk of people. From 5th sem students become eligible for placements but in 5th sem, no company came to our college for placement this year. Only in the 6th sem, the placement cell started. Companies that visited till now ( some of them came to take interns and didn't offer full-time jobs) 1) Clevertize, 2) Social Panga, 3) Robert Bosch GmbH, 4) Saatchi & Saatchi, 5) Publicis, 6)PR Pundit, 7) McKinsey, 8) Edsol Edtech, 9) Momo Media, 10) MSL, 11) Genesis BC, Offers: 1.5-3 LPA (average). I plan to send CVs personally to companies through LINKEDIN and other job search platforms because the college hasn't provided us with good placement offers as claimed.
